Why should I buy a permanently installed automatic standby generator instead of a portable generator?
During a power outage, an automatic standby generator provides numerous advantages over a portable generator:
- The American Red Cross recommends permanently installed standby generators as a safer way to provide backup power to a home than a portable generator.
- With an automatic standby generator properly installed outside, your home is protected from deadly carbon monoxide poisoning that is a much greater risk with portable generators.
- Running on the home's natural gas fuel supply is less expensive than gasoline and does not need to be refilled.
- They start automatically within seconds of a power outage, and eliminate the need to haul a portable generator outside or run extension cords throughout your home.
- They provide protection 24/7, whether you're home or away, and they turn themselves off when utility power returns, so there is no need to monitor the unit during an outage.
How do I correctly size a generator for my home?
The most logical way to determine your needs is to envision your home without power! Some outages may be short in duration, while others could last for days or weeks. What would you like your living conditions to be? Do you just need lights and a few appliances or do you want to power your entire home, including your air conditioner or furnace?
Generators typically come with predetermined numbers of circuits based on the generator's kW power rating. Eight circuits are supplied for the eight kW generator and as many as 16 circuits are supplied for the 17 kW generator. Each circuit is directly connected to a matched circuit on the home's main circuit breaker panel, providing electricity to that specific appliance or area of the home.
We recommend consulting with a participating dealer or a qualified electrician to accurately and safely determine the right size generator based on your needs.

Why is it better to choose natural gas to fuel my generator instead of gasoline or propane?
The most important reason to choose a natural gas generator is reliability. Natural gas pipelines are buried underground so they're less susceptible to damaging winds and flooding common with severe storms. Natural gas is also delivered directly to your home. You won't have to worry about storing or running out of fuel because a fuel truck can't reach your home or neighborhood gas station. And even if gasoline is available at the pump, gasoline pumps won't work without electricity. Finally, natural gas typically costs less for emergency generation than gasoline or propane.
How they work
What do I need to do during a power outage?
Relax. Natural gas standby generators start automatically within seconds of sensing a power outage. Once electric power is restored, the generator shuts down allowing service to flow from the electric utility. And just to make sure they work when you need them, natural gas generators automatically test themselves each week. For more information, view Generac's how-to video now. To ensure that your generator can support you during an extended power outage, ask your generator dealer to run a full load test for a minimum of one hour following final installation.
What is the difference between an automatic air-cooled generator and an automatic liquid-cooled generator?
The engines! Air-cooled generators come with engines that use fans to force air across the engine for cooling, while liquid-cooled generators use enclosed radiator systems for cooling, similar to an automobile. Generally, liquid-cooled engines are used on larger kW generators due to the larger engines required for the higher power output.
How long can I expect an automatic standby generator to last?
With typical usage and proper maintenance, an automatic standby generator will operate 1,500 to 3,000 hours providing years of reliable service.
Do they have to be maintained?
Yes, simple maintenance is required. All generators require periodic oil and filter changes to ensure maximum performance for years of reliable service. Preventative maintenance kits are available and many participating dealers offer annual maintenance contracts for a worry-free ownership experience. Refer to the owner’s manual for routine maintenance procedures and schedules.
Cost
How much does a generator cost?
Prices vary based upon the need for whole house or partial service and where the generator is installed. A standard installation package for a 2,000 square foot home usually requires a 16 to 17 kilowatt generator, which costs approximately $8,500 to $10,000 and typically includes six feet of electric and six feet of gas line, city permits and licenses required for the installation. The participating dealer will help you determine the most cost-effective solution for you.
Please note that list prices found at hardware and home improvement stores typically reflect the purchase cost of the generator and not the total installed cost. I already have a natural gas meter, what else do I need from CenterPoint Energy before my generator can be installed?
Generators require a steady supply of natural gas at a specific pressure to operate properly. In some cases, this might require an upgrade of your existing meter to serve your generator and other natural gas appliances or an additional service line and meter. Your participating dealer will make this assessment along with the assistance of a trained CenterPoint Energy representative, if necessary. The dealer will review your desired generator location, gauge its proximity to your natural gas and electric services, review local permitting and code requirements and calculate the costs. If CenterPoint Energy installs an additional natural gas service line and meter, each month you will receive a separate bill for your second meter.
Another important advantage to working with a professionally trained participating dealer and a CenterPoint Energy service representative is that you can be assured of adequate pressure to operate your generator. Only a CenterPoint Energy service representative is familiar with the local gas distribution system and can determine if pressure in the main lines is sufficient.
